We’re ready to respond 24/7

Last year, we were dispatched to 2,132 missions, including road traffic collisions, medical emergencies, accidental injuries and other trauma incidents. We depend on the generosity of our supporters to continue delivering a first-class pre-hospital emergency medical service to the people of Essex, Hertfordshire and surrounding areas. It costs in excess of £1,000,000 every month to cover all charitable costs, with an average mission cost of £2,800.
